I ended up going to Walgreen's and purchased Sudafed from the pharmacist. It was kind of weird because Sudafed is an OTC medication, but when you purchase it, you have to buy it from the pharmacist directly, they card you, and you have to sign a log. Apparently people use Sudafed to make crystal meth. I learned that from my Staff...you learn something new every day! :) I took it a couple of times over the weekend and I've been fine since.
